Moskwa Concert History

1983 - in a dirty, covered with smoke of the factory chimneys Polish town Lodz, the band Moskwa (Moscow) was formed - a big legend of Polish underground, one of the most original and charismatic bands of the Eastern-Europe punkrock scene. From the very beginning the most important role in the band played Pawel "Guma" Gumola - guitarist , singer, and author of almost all songs and lyrics, who soon became a symbol of the new movement.
